Born between 1977 and 1994, the youngest Millennials turn 18 this year; the oldest are well into their thirties—which means ‘those kids’ are actually the ones having kids of their own.

The Gen Y consumer is graduating into parenthood are bringing a whole new set of ‘family values’ with them. From their green-mindedness to their leaning on Boomer grandparents, these young parents are carving a different parental path.
